Going to pick up my new toy this weekend. It would appear that someone painted the boat with out proper prep. I'm thinking maybe it wasn't primed. The guy I had check the boat out for me said the hull is in beautiful shape, no blemishes or anything. I'm thinking I may repaint the hull sides. I've been looking at the Awlcraft 2000 topside paint.
I'm thinking I'd carefully sand it back to the gel coat, prime and repaint. My thought is what to do at the waterline. I'm afraid if I just tape at the line, sand, prime and paint it will give me problems at the waterline. Any input? Here's what is happening now.
